Transaction 4dd33e602e2dc933f7909a3215bc0bc130da42642db9451656dcc76a5b2acf2f

1 Input
1 Outputs
  • 4dd33e602e2dc933f7909a3215bc0bc130da42642db9451656dcc76a5b2acf2f:0
  • value  1250000000
    address  muE7BXCc92fNNZ8KW5eDDQLVCMkVsf4wuq